0

ブラウザーで ServiceStack エンドポイントを表示すると、非常に役立つデータのスナップショットが便利な HTML テーブルに表示されます。タイトルは次のようになります。

Snapshot of EndPoint generated by ServiceStack on DateTime

DateTime表示されているのはフォーマットされているようで、そのUTC理由を解明しようとしています。英国では現在、英国夏時間 (UTC +1) であるため、ServiceStack は常に間違った時刻を表示します。

ソースコードはこちら: https://github.com/ServiceStack/ServiceStack/blob/master/src/ServiceStack/WebHost.Endpoints/Formats/HtmlFormat.cs#L63

私の質問は:

これは小さなバグですか、それとも日付と時刻を UTC で表示することについて私が認識していない別の理由がありますか?

4

1 に答える 1

0

日付は常に UTC として送信されます。ServiceStack の HTML5 レポート形式の目的は、Web サービスからのデータをわかりやすい形式で表示することです。

于 2013-04-16T14:28:20.917 に答える